Why Reliable Salt Supply Matters in Wisconsin Winters

Wisconsin's dependable road salt supply directly influences crash rates, emergency response times, and municipal budgets. You structure operations around lane-miles, storm frequency, and level-of-service targets because road safety copyrights on hitting application rates when pavement temperatures drop. Data demonstrates timely salting can reduce crashes by 20-30%, reducing EMS deployments and overtime. You also protect infrastructure protection goals by calibrating chloride use to minimize corrosion of bridges, guardrails, and vehicles, decreasing lifecycle costs.

Policy choices matter. Multi-year agreements, diverse vendor relationships, and open usage documentation support accurate budget planning and spending validation. You align inventory thresholds with storm severity indices and focus on critical corridors-healthcare centers, schools, transportation routes-to preserve mobility. Appropriately scaled spreaders, proactive icing prevention methods, and staff education further enhance cost optimization while preserving service levels.

Dependable Product Availability and Immediate Availability

Because storms won't await purchase orders, you maintain consistent salt inventory with defined minimums tied to lane‑miles, storm severity read more indices, and supplier lead times. You document these thresholds in procurement policy, so replenishment initiates automatically when on‑hand hits the reorder point. You verify inventory accuracy with weekly cycle counts and reconcile usage after each event to reduce variances.

You apply demand forecasting by employing five‑year storm histories, NOAA outlooks, and treatment rates per lane‑mile. That model determines pre‑season buys, mid‑season top‑offs, and contingency buffers without inflating carrying costs. You organize stock by priority routes and distinguish treated vs. untreated product for faster deployment. Clear SOPs specify who orders, who verifies, and who reports burn rates, providing on‑demand availability while protecting your budget.
